Carbendazim 35% WP A Comprehensive Overview
Carbendazim is a broad-spectrum benzimidazole fungicide that has gained prominence in agriculture for its effectiveness against a wide range of fungal diseases. The formulation of Carbendazim at 35% wettable powder (WP) is particularly beneficial for various applications in crop protection. This article will delve into its characteristics, application, benefits, and safety considerations.
Characteristics of Carbendazim 35% WP
Carbendazim is a systemic fungicide that functions by inhibiting the synthesis of fungal cell walls, effectively halting the growth and spread of pathogens. The 35% WP formulation allows for easy dispersion in water, making it suitable for various application methods, including spraying and soil treatment. Due to its high concentration, just a small amount of product can be used to achieve effective control of diseases such as powdery mildew, rusts, leaf spots, and blights across various crops, including fruits, vegetables, and ornamental plants.
Applications in Agriculture
Farmers utilize Carbendazim 35% WP to protect a variety of crops from severe fungal infections. It can be applied pre-emptively or at the first sign of disease symptoms. The fungicide is particularly popular in managing post-harvest decay, which can have significant economic impacts. Its effectiveness extends to several horticultural crops, grains, and pulses, thus serving as an essential tool in integrated pest management (IPM) programs.
Benefits of Using Carbendazim 35% WP
One of the key advantages of Carbendazim is its versatility. With efficacy against numerous fungal pathogens, it reduces the need for multiple fungicides, simplifying the pest control process. Additionally, Carbendazim has a relatively low toxicity profile for humans and animals, provided that it is used according to label instructions. Its systemic action also means that it can offer prolonged disease protection, ensuring healthier crops and higher yields.
Safety Considerations
While Carbendazim is generally safe when used correctly, it is essential to follow safety guidelines to minimize any potential risks. Protective gear such as gloves and masks should be worn during application to avoid skin contact and inhalation. It is also crucial to adhere to recommended application rates and intervals to prevent the development of resistance in fungi.
